How to Keep Boots Smelling Fresh
Instructions
-
-
1
Wear effective socks that will prevent moisture from getting into the boot. For example, hiking socks are designed to trap moisture away from both your feet and the boots. Socks like these will prevent stinky boots and will also fight athlete’s foot.
-
2
Let your boots air dry after you have worn them for any length of time. Remove the insoles and lay them out as well. This will allow the area under the insoles to dry out.
-
3
Rinse the boots out with water if your feet perspire. Run some clean water through the boot, shake the boot, dump the water and let it air dry.
-
4
Place odor-absorbing insoles, or powder in your boots. This will absorb any smells emanating from your footwear.
